Brazil Agriculture Market Analysis

The Agriculture In Brazil Market size is estimated at USD 102.73 billion in 2025, and is expected to reach USD 116.80 billion by 2030, at a CAGR of 2.6% during the forecast period (2025-2030).

Brazil's vast agricultural capabilities position it as one of the world's top exporters of fruits and vegetables. Globally, it ranks as the third-largest producer of fruits. In 2022, Brazil accounted for 60% of Europe's fruit imports. Leading the charge, Brazil exports grapes, plums, apples, and blueberries. Additionally, it supplies avocados, cherries, walnuts, pears, peaches, and raspberries. In 2022, mangoes and grapes dominated the export scene, constituting 21.1% and 11.0% of the total fruit export value, respectively. Table grapes are emerging as a significant export, with nearly 80% of Brazil's production catering to the export market, emphasizing high-quality and modern grape varieties. In the first half of 2023, Brazil exported 89 metric tons of lime, marking it a leading export. This surge is linked to Brazil's newfound access to the Chilean market for its Tahiti lime. Apples rank among Brazil's top export fruits. Brazil is rejuvenating old orchards with modern varieties like Jazz, Envy, Brookfield, Rosy Glow, and Ambrosia to enhance apple production and boost exports. Yet, challenges loom: a shrinking apple planting area, driven by low profits and fierce international competition, could dampen future exports. In 2022, Brazil's lemon and lime exports hit 156,253.0 metric tons, fetching a value of USD 152,191.0 thousand. Projections estimate exports will climb to 189,214.6 metric tons by the end of the forecast period, achieving a annual growth rate of 3.2%.

Key drivers propelling Brazil's fruit and vegetable market include technological advancements, a growing population, robust economic growth, and a consistent supply of produce. Dominant in Brazilian consumption are oranges, bananas, tomatoes, watermelons, and onions. To bolster exports and meet domestic demand, the government is channeling investments into agriculture, emphasizing the adoption of new technologies. The Government of Brazil (GoB) unveiled a record allocation of BRL 475.5 billion (USD 88.2 billion) for the 2024/25 Crop Plan to strengthen its agricultural industry. This primary public policy focuses on agricultural credit and financing. While the 2024/25 allocation marks a nominal record, representing a 9% increase from the previous year's BRL 435.8 billion (USD 80.9 billion) allocation, representatives from the agricultural industry argue that the funds fall short. They contend that the allocation is inadequate to support farmers grappling with tough market challenges, including declining international commodity prices and soaring production costs. Tomatoes have witnessed the steepest rise in consumer demand. Varieties like Roma or Italian tomatoes, prized for their thick, meaty flesh, are ideal for processing into sauces, pastes, and purees, commanding higher market prices than traditional consumption varieties. National and international dietary guidelines champion the consumption of fresh fruits, underscoring their nutritional benefits. This endorsement has heightened fruit popularity among Brazil's health-conscious consumers. The growing presence of fruits and vegetables in retail and online platforms propels their consumption in Brazil.

Brazil Agriculture Market News

  • August 2024: The ApexBrasil program, which incentivizes exports, successfully connected buyers from 63 countries, projecting an impressive USD 86.05 million (BRL 470 million) to boost the agricultural industry.
  • April 2024: Brazil targeted self-sufficiency in wheat by harnessing the Cerrado biome, a savanna-like expanse in its central region. The government plans to rejuvenate nearly 4 million hectares of degraded land for wheat cultivation, employing specially adapted seed varieties that can withstand the area's dry climate and soil conditions, outpacing the projected national production of about 9.5 million tons for the marketing year (2024-2025).
